Hershel Edward Henson, 87, of McDonough, GA., formerly of Poplar Bluff, MO. died Thursday, May 18, 2006, at the Henry Medical Center, in Stockbridge, GA.
Mr. Henson was born Feb. 16, 1919, in Collinswood, TN. He was a member of the Seventh Day Adventist Church, and had retired in 1994 from the surgery department of Doctor's Hospital, in Poplar Bluff, MO. Mr. Henson was also a veteran of the United States Army, having served during World War II.
Survivors include two daughters, Marie Merritt of Brooksville, FL. and Ann N. Malson, of Atlanta, GA; a son, Dr. Earl Douglas Henson, of Atlanta, GA; a brother Wayne Henson, Jr., of Poplar Bluff, MO; seven grandchildren, eight great-grandchildren and one great-great grandchild.
Visitation will begin at 1 p.m. Sunday at the Seventh Day Adventist Church, in Poplar Bluff, MO. The funeral service will follow at 2 p.m. at the Church, with Pastor Glenn Marshall officiating. Burial, with full military honors, will be at 10 a.m. Monday at the City Cemetery, in Poplar Bluff, MO.
Cotrell Funeral Service, of Poplar Bluff, MO is in charge of the arrangements.
